What Is a Forward Deployed Engineer? (And Why We Built Something Different)

A forward deployed engineer works inside a customer's business and ships software on their problems. The model is half right. Here is what the job actually looks like, and what we built instead.
A forward deployed engineer is a software engineer who works inside a customer's business instead of at their own company's office. They sit with the customer's team. They learn the workflows. Then they build and ship software that solves that customer's specific problems, using their employer's platform.
Palantir invented the role. OpenAI and Anthropic made it famous again. Every AI company now wants FDEs because AI products don't work off the shelf. Someone has to close the gap between the model and the messy real business.
That's the definition. Now let me tell you what the job actually looks like. Because I think the FDE model is half right. And the half that's wrong is the reason we built something different.
What FDEs actually do all week
One FDE at an AI startup described his week in public. It stuck with me.
Ten clients at once. Fifty hours a week. Half the time in meetings. The other half building, testing, and fixing things under pressure. Dozens of Slack workspaces. Two builds running at the same time. Permanent firefighting.
His sharpest line: the job is less about building AI systems and more about understanding businesses well enough to know what to build.
He's right about that last part. Dead right.
But look at the model. One human, ten clients, fifty hours. That's not engineering. That's triage. Every client gets a slice of a tired person. And the person burns out.
Why companies want one anyway
Because the alternative is worse.
Most companies bought AI tools. Some ran pilots. Very few have systems running in production that their own teams use every day. The gap between "we tested it" and "we run on it" is where all the value dies.
An FDE closes that gap by force. They sit inside your business until the thing works.
Here's the problem nobody says out loud. A classic FDE walks in cold. They spend their first months learning your business from zero. You pay for that learning curve. Every time.

Forward deployed engineer FAQs
Is a forward deployed engineer the same as a consultant?
No. Consultants advise and leave a deck. FDEs build and ship working software inside your business.
How much does a forward deployed engineer cost?
It depends on the vendor and the load. What matters more is what you pay for. An FDE is sold as a person's time. An Operator in Residence is priced against the tools that ship, because agents carry the build volume and the discovery phase does not exist.
Do I need to be technical to work with one?
No. The whole point is that your existing team, trained on the method, operates everything after it ships.
What does "forward deployed" mean?
It's a military term. Forward deployed units are stationed where the action is, not back at base. A forward deployed engineer works at the customer, not at headquarters.
